Abstract(in English) The aim of this work is to promote service-oriented cloud computing architecture into robotics development. Service-Oriented Architecture (SOA) and Cloud Computing have been pushing the blooming of web development by creating a great ecosystem for collaborative development. This work infuses these two concepts into a development of a virtual robotics platform. The cloud-based architecture consists of four main components, namely (1) Central Server, (2) Robot Controller, (3) Service Provider, and (4) Client System. Several Service Provider modules are developed and discussed in this paper. A virtual implementation of a social robot is discussed for the validation of the service-oriented cloud computing architecture in robotics development.
